Home
Blog
Medicine Search
Medicine A-Z List
Home
Medicine Search
Price Comparison
Carvedil 25mg Tablet Alkem Laboratories Ltd 65cf6c162093e966653d1802
carvedil 25mg tablet
price list India
alkem laboratories ltd